What is social positioning and how does it affect the workplace? Social positioning is defined as how someone’s identity affects the experience they have in society, which, in turn, impacts how they see others. Social Positioning has a significant place in the workplace and on how individuals each experience it. Why people don’t tell their employers they’re neurodivergent. Nearly a third of neurodivergent people surveyed for CIPD and Uptimize’s new report on neuroinclusion at work said they haven’t told their line manager or HR about their neurodivergence. For some, it’s just private, but others have real concerns that they could be disadvantaged. With one in five neurodivergent staff experiencing harassment or discrimination, it’s no wonder people feel they need to hide who they are. 🤔 What can be done to build workplaces that genuinely include, support, and celebrate neurodivergent colleagues? #Neuroinclusion #Neurodiversity #Inclusion #Diversity #EDI #Equality #NeuroinclusionAtWork
